Introduction to ITC Limited

Founded in 1910 as the Imperial Tobacco Company of India, ITC has evolved into a multi-industry giant headquartered in Kolkata, West Bengal. Today, it operates across several sectors, including cigarettes, FMCG, hotels, paperboards and packaging, agribusiness, and information technology. With well-known brands like Aashirvaad, Sunfeast, Bingo!, and Classmate, ITC enjoys a strong presence in over 6 million retail outlets across India and exports to more than 90 countries.

ITC’s financial stability, minimal debt, and consistent dividend payouts make it a staple in many investment portfolios. However, its heavy reliance on the cigarette business—accounting for around 40% of revenue—exposes it to regulatory risks, while its diversification efforts into FMCG and hospitality signal growth potential. Market Overview: ITC in Context

ITC operates in a competitive yet promising market. India’s FMCG sector is projected to grow at a CAGR of 7-9% through 2030, driven by rising disposable incomes and urbanization. The tobacco industry, while mature, remains profitable despite regulatory scrutiny. Meanwhile, the hospitality and agribusiness sectors benefit from India’s economic expansion and global trade opportunities.
